The Tenancy Deposit Scheme (TDS) – Are You Prepared?

The Tenancy Deposit Scheme  is  part  of the new legislation brought in by the Housing Act 2004 and came into effect on 06 April 2007.

From 06 April 2007 all deposits received by letting agents and landlords from tenants for Assured Shorthold Tenancies (AST’s)  in England and Wales must be protected by a Government-authorised Tenancy Deposit Protection Scheme.

The  legislation  has come about to help protect deposits paid by tenants and make sure that  they  are  dealt  with  fairly  and  receive  all  or  part  of  the   deposit   back   where
appropriate.

Existing tenancies (AST’s) will not be affected, nor will tenancies that run onto a periodic tenancy after this date. However, tenancies that are renewed (i.e. a new AST is created) will  be  affected. The  only  way  to  avoid  this  new  legislation  would be not receive a deposit, but we do not recommend this. 

There  are  penalties  for not complying with the scheme and landlords / letting agencies must  carry  the  costs  and  carry  out  the  appropriate  administration at the start of the tenancy. All tenants must be notified as to where their deposit is held.

There  are  3  authorised  schemes available for holding deposits which were finalised in early  2007.  Landlords  and  agents can choose from one custodial scheme run by the Deposit Protection Service and two insured schemes. At first avenue we will be joining the custodial scheme run by the Deposit Protection Service.

The Deposit Protection Service – Custodial Scheme

This  is  the  only  custodial  scheme  available  and  is  run  by  Computershare Investor Services Plc  who  have  been awarded a contract by the government and will be funded
by the interest earned on the deposits held.

The  tenant  will  pay the deposit to the landlord/letting agent, who will then pay it into the scheme  within  14  days.  At  the end of the tenancy, if the landlord and the tenant agree how  the  deposit  should  be  repaid, they will tell the scheme administrator, who will pay out  the  money  as  agreed, plus any interest earned on their share. This refund process takes  up  to  10 working days and requires repayment ID codes issued to both parties at the  start  of  the  tenancy by the scheme. An independent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R) will resolve any disputes relating in returning deposits. 

Landlords  and  letting  agents will be able to deal with their deposits online unless paper based transactions are required.

How Does This Affect You?

If you are a landlord and receive a security deposit for a new AST tenancy from 06 April 2007,  it  will  be  your responsibility  to  ensure  that  it  is  dealt with in line with the new legislation.
